Identification of Key Pathways and Establishment of a Seven-Gene Prognostic Signature in Cervical Cancer
2021-04-05
Abstract excerpt
<title>Abstract</title> <p><bold>Background:</bold> Cervical cancer (CC) remains high morbidity and mortality. We aimed to identify critical pathways underlying cervical carcinogenesis and establish a prognostic signature.<bold>Methods:</bold> Six datasets from the gene expression omnibus (GEO) database were used to screen the differentially expressed genes (DEGs) between CC and normal tissues.
